Customers often highlight the keyboard's excellent typing experience, praising its quality, ease of use, and lightweight design. Many appreciate the integrated stand and strong magnets for secure attachment. However, some users express concerns about the keyboard's stability, particularly when used on a lap, and find the price to be relatively high.

Practically a Must-Have for Pixel Slate
|
Posted .
This reviewer received promo considerations or sweepstakes entry for writing a review.
The Google Keyboard for Pixel Slate is practically a must-have, especially if you do a lot of inputting. More than the Pixel Slate itself, it’s the keyboard that makes the experience of using the tablet rich. The keys are quiet and have just the proper feel and spacing. An integrated touchpad is so natural that you’ll often forget that the Pixel Slate screen is touch sensitive, too. The back cover adjusts the screen to almost any angle with a smooth motion. Note, the cover uses strong magnets. I accidentally put my phone on top of my closed cover and was surprised how much force was needed to pick up the phone.
Google includes a key that launches Google Assistant. Press it and you can speak to the tablet like you would any Google speaker. To save space, there is no Caps Lock. If you type a lot in all caps, you might want to stop shouting in your communications. Or you can reprogram the Ctrl key to serve as Caps Lock.
The keyboard has a backlight. But, in what seems like a documentation oversight, the backlight adjustment does not show up in the Settings panel of the Pixel Slate. To adjust the backlight, use the Alt key with the screen brightness buttons on the keyboard. By the way, the icons on the brightness buttons look very similar to the icon used by Settings.
Attaching the Pixel Slate to the keyboard is via a built-in snap connector. The tablet automatically recognizes the keyboard and orients itself to landscape. The keyboard adds weight to the Pixel Slate, which is already heavier than I expected for a tablet. The combo is still portable, but a little less so together.
The only real downside to the keyboard is that the combined purchase price of the tablet and keyboard rivals high-end Chromebooks. And if you’re typing enough that a keyboard makes sense, you’ll have to decide which form factor works better for you: table + keyboard or Chromebook.
